Johan Matti Juhani Puhakka vs Marcos Andre Garcia Junior 2025 European Jiu-Jitsu IBJJF Championship

Johan Matti Juhani Puhakka vs Marcos Andre Garcia Junior 2025 European Jiu-Jitsu IBJJF Championship

Johan Matti Juhani Puhakka vs Marcos Andre Garcia Junior 2025 European Jiu-Jitsu IBJJF Championship